The Best Games Are the Ones That Change Us

Games have a special ability to entertain, challenge, and sometimes even transform the way we slotcc think. The best games are not necessarily the ones with the highest sales or the biggest budgets—they’re the ones that leave a lasting impression. Whether it’s through emotional storytelling, breathtaking worlds, or groundbreaking mechanics, these games change the way we experience the medium and how we talk about it with others.

Titles like “Journey,” “Undertale,” and “Inside” prove that minimalism and emotional depth can rival blockbuster action. These best games engage players with more than just skill; they create an experience that touches something deeper. They’re often quiet, thoughtful, or daring in concept, and that courage is what makes them memorable. Not every game needs to be loud to be powerful.

PlayStation games have been at the forefront of this quiet revolution. From the haunting world of “Bloodborne” to the introspective narrative of “Everybody’s Gone to the Rapture,” Sony’s consoles have consistently supported games that take creative risks. Even the more action-heavy titles—like “Ghost of Tsushima” or “Death Stranding”—have moments of deep beauty and reflection. These PlayStation games prove that entertainment and art are not mutually exclusive.

As the medium matures, so too do its creators and its audience. The best games will continue to be those that aren’t afraid to be different, to challenge assumptions, and to connect emotionally. They make us feel, reflect, and sometimes even change our perspectives—and that is why they stay with us long after the screen fades to black.
